Toby jug, earthenware, modelled in the form of a standing corpulent male figure wearing a tricorn hat, coat, waistcoat, knee breeches, stockings and buckled shoes, the figure holding a small foaming jug in his right hand and a long-stemmed pipe in his left, the hat forms the mouth of the jug, the figure standing on a moulded base and supprted behind by a moulded tree stump which tapers at the top into a loop handle modelled in the form of a branch and twisted back down the tree stump; the figure painted with realistic face, black hat, brown coat, pink waistcoat, yellow breeches and black shoes, the small jug held by the figure painted with the inscription "SUCCESS / TO OUR / WOODEN WALLS" in black and enclosed by a heart-shaped border, the moulded base, tree stump and handle painted in browns and greens.
